
Our event supports the Kevin Renderman Courageous Heart Fund, which operates in the honor and memory of Kevin. Sidelined by a brain tumor at 23 years old, Kevin applied his never-quit attitude to everyday life. He inspired countless people with his strength and courage. Kevin died January 30, 2015, but his spirit lives on in those who knew and loved him.
In his honor, we fund the Courageous Heart Scholarship, which is awarded annually to an eighth grader from St. Christina attending Marist High School. This award recipient models strength, courage, and compassion and a no-quit attitude, characteristics that Kevin had.
We also support organizations that provide services to persons with cancer or traumatic brain disorders including St. Xavier, Next Steps, Shirley Ryan Ability, Rescare, Christmas Without Cancer, and Mulliganeers. To date, over $140,000 has been awarded in scholarship money, along with over $50,000 given to other organizations.
